The Federal Capital Territory chapter of the All Progressives Congress, APC, has condemned minister Nyesom Wike for appointing members of the Peoples Democratic Party in Rivers state into positions.
The FCT chapter of the party expressed its displeasure in a press conference in Abuja on Monday, criticizing the minister for overlooking indigenous people and APC members in the appointments.
A chieftain of the party Abdulwahab Ekekhide, accused Mr Wike of “killing the political structure of the APC in FCT due to his lack of regard for the party and its leadership,” adding that he ignored several letters from the party seeking to meet with him.
“We call on Mr. President to caution the minister. Let him start empowering the party or else, the APC will struggle to get two percent and the President may lose the next area council election in 2027 if the situation remains this way.
“These recent appointments have shown that Wike wants to finally kill and bury the party. His agenda we don’t know but we will resist any further attempts to ridicule the party,” he added.

He also alleged that the APC loses elections in the FCT because “successive ministers import strangers who do not belong to any political ward or polling unit or have voting rights as appointees. But when it is time for general elections, they will pack their baggage and travel to their various states, leaving the FCT dry.”
The party’s youth leader in the FCT, Isaac David threatened that if Wike continues to deny party members their rights after working so hard for the President’s electoral victory, they might be forced to withdraw their support for the President.
“The minister’s PVC wasn’t registered in the FCT here. Same goes to the PDP loyalists and supporters he is bringing into Abuja for appointments. If they are ignoring us, the indigenes and the FCT APC members, we will see who will vote him back in 2027,” he said.
David, added that the APC youths in the FCT will “withdraw our support from Mr President. Let us see how he plans to win the FCT in 2027.”
